Jobber
Jobber is a user-friendly software designed for landscapers who want to streamline their scheduling and invoicing processes. Its key features include:
- Scheduling: Create and manage schedules, set reminders, and assign tasks to team members.
- Invoicing: Generate professional invoices, track payments, and send reminders.
Pros: • Easy to use and navigate • Excellent customer support • Scalable for growing businesses Cons: • Limited customization options • Some users find the mobile app slow Best Feature: Jobber's automated scheduling feature saves landscapers time and reduces errors.
LawnPro
LawnPro is a comprehensive software that helps landscapers estimate, schedule, and manage their projects. Its key features include:
- Estimating: Create custom estimates with prices, materials, and labor costs.
- Scheduling: Manage schedules, set reminders, and assign tasks to team members.
Pros: • Robust estimating and scheduling features • Excellent customer support • Integrates with popular accounting software Cons: • Steeper learning curve compared to Jobber • Some users find the user interface cluttered Best Feature: LawnPro's estimating feature allows landscapers to create accurate estimates quickly, reducing the risk of under or overcharging clients.
Landscaper Pro
Landscaper Pro is a project management software designed for small to medium-sized landscaping businesses. Its key features include:
- Project Management: Create and manage projects, set deadlines, and track progress.
- Invoicing: Generate professional invoices, track payments, and send reminders.
Pros: • Robust project management features • Excellent customer support • Integrates with popular accounting software Cons: • Limited scalability for large businesses • Some users find the user interface outdated Best Feature: Landscaper Pro's project management feature allows landscapers to track progress, set deadlines, and manage multiple projects efficiently.
When choosing a landscaping software tool, consider your specific needs and requirements. Jobber is ideal for small businesses looking to streamline their scheduling and invoicing processes. LawnPro is suitable for larger businesses that require robust estimating and scheduling features. Landscaper Pro is perfect for small to medium-sized businesses that need project management and invoicing capabilities.
